American sweetheart Karlie Kloss has been a modeling sensation since she was 15. With a background in ballet and a keen interest in coding, Karlie has proven herself to be a multifaceted talent. Her notable achievements include walking for Victoria's Secret, appearing in campaigns for Adidas and Swarovski, and gracing the covers of Teen Vogue and Elle. supermodels from 7 17 top
Conversely, today’s top models operate as . Platforms like Instagram and TikTok have democratized how models communicate with fans. A modern supermodel is expected to be an influencer, an activist, an entrepreneur, and a digital creator all at once. While the 90s icons relied on fashion editors to choose them, today's top tier commands power because they bring their own audience directly to the luxury fashion labels.

The longest-running Victoria’s Secret Angel (2000–2018), Adriana Lima brought passion and intensity. Known for her striking blue eyes and religious commitment to fitness, she walked more VS shows than any other model. She proved that a supermodel could be both a sex symbol and a devoted mother. Niki Taylor became the youngest person ever to sign a multi‑million‑dollar contract with CoverGirl and the youngest to appear on the cover of Vogue , all by the age of 17.
After the success of Elle Macpherson, Australia waited for its next export. Miranda Kerr, with her dimples and devout positive attitude, became the first Australian Victoria’s Secret Angel. She later created KORA Organics , proving that supermodels can be successful beauty entrepreneurs.
